Greville Street Library now open at the Prahran Town Hall

Published on 25 September 2025

To celebrate the opening of Greville Street Library at the Prahran Town Hall, we’re holding a free family event on Saturday 11 October.

We have lots of fun activities planned for all to enjoy.

Come along to discover - or rediscover - your much-loved modernised library, now with a larger collection, more study areas, public computers, and space for programs and events!

Dive into new books, try your hand at collage and boomerang painting, and enjoy Storytime with special guest readers, Mayor Councillor Melina Sehr and Koorie and Jardwadjali / Gunditjmara Elder, Aunty Titta Secombe. 

Explore and learn about Greville Street through the ages with a display and talk by our history team.  

Seventeen exciting artworks from Stonnington’s contemporary art collection are on public view at the library. Come along to view the artworks in a guided tour and learn about the artists and their significance to Stonnington.

Join the future play lab for regenerative play in the library and on Greville Street, and engage in music games, new sports and play about place.

Swing by the Victoria Police and Crime Stoppers booth! Whether you want free license plate screws, tips on preventing theft, or just a chat with local officers - they'll be there.

Come and chat to the William Angliss Skills and Jobs Centre team, who can provide tips and advice on searching for and applying for jobs.

Everyone is welcome to come along and join us in the celebrations!

Saturday 11 October

10am to 1pm

Prahran Town Hall

This event is free and bookings are not required.
